    Default Re: Babb too nervous, should have been pulled!

    Well you should have a problem with it. The best player that we have should start at that position.

    However, I don't see how everyone who wathces football should undoubtedly know that Desormeaux is a better quaterback than Babb. Is he more electric, of course. Can he do things with his feet that Babb can't, sure, is Babb still mobile, yes.

    I have no problem saying that Desormeaux is the quaterback of the future, and I think he will be great when his time comes. Babb has been the leader of the turnaround of this program. We were 1-2 las year without Babb, 1-3 if you count UCF when he got hurt in the 1st quarter. Is that Desormeaux's fault, of course not. But maybe we shouldn't discount what we have.

    Some statistics:

    Passing:
    Babb: 74 completions on 119 attempts 3 INT, 3 TD
    Desormeaux: 62 completions on 117 attempts 5 INT, 0 TD

    Yards Per Completion:
    Babb - 11.6
    Des - 9.6

    Yards Per Carry:
    Babb - 6.2
    Des - 5.6

    Rushing Touchdowns:
    Babb - 4
    Des - 3

    Still, I love what Des brings to the field, and he is extremely exciting, just don't see how you can say its obvious he is the better qb.
